from 1UP.COM:
Two interesting Xbox-related rumors popped up on the web today. According to popular gizmo website Engadget, the official name for the next generation Xbox, often referred to as Xbox Next, Xbox 2, or Xenon, is actually "Xbox 360." According to Engadget, the name was test-marketed and a source working on the project has confirmed it to them.
